poetry: Run poetry env use only after cache is loaded

The virtualenv cache might contain invalid entries, such as virtualenvs
built in previous, buggy versions of this action.  The `poetry env use`
command will recreate virtualenvs in case they are invalid, but it has
to be run only *after* the cache is loaded.

Refactor `CacheDistributor` a bit such that the validation (and possible
recreation) of virtualenvs happens only after the cache is loaded.

protected async handleLoadedCache() {
await super.handleLoadedCache();
// After the cache is loaded -- make sure virtualenvs use the correct Python version (the one that we have just installed).
// This will handle invalid caches, recreating virtualenvs if necessary.
const pythonLocation = await io.which('python');
if (pythonLocation) {
core.debug(`pythonLocation is ${pythonLocation}`);
} else {
logWarning('python binaries were not found in PATH');
return;
}
for (const poetryProject of this.poetryProjects) {
const {exitCode, stderr} = await exec.getExecOutput(
'poetry',
['env', 'use', pythonLocation],
{ignoreReturnCode: true, cwd: poetryProject}
);
if (exitCode) {
logWarning(stderr);
}
}
}
